There are many forms that water can take that will destroy your personal property. Burst plumbing pipes can practically level a house, as will external storming and flooding. Basements can swell with ground water; roofs can blow off in terrible storms allowing even more rain get on the inside. The aforementioned fire hoses and even city sewage systems can come undone and cause great damage to dwellings.
If any building you are occupying is suffering some harm, the first piece of good news is that it is then still standing. Severe flooding carries buildings away, and a restorable dwelling indicates a somewhat sound foundation. So the first think to do is look down at that foundation. The floors are sure to be a wreck, as they take the bulk of the wet.
All floor coverings must be removed for a thorough inspection to take place. In case of flooding, all carpeting and vinyl flooring will probably be ruined. Tile and marble floors can leak, causing damage to the sub floors underneath. Again, removal of materials is probably going to be necessary for a professional inspection.
The walls can be in a bad state along with the floors, particularly those walls at the level of deepest flooding. As the water raises it soaks into to wallboard and plywood, destroying the surface paints and stains along with the underlying wooden framing. Further, untreated dampness can create a mold problem in the future, and perhaps pest issues as well. Again, removal and inspection may be necessary.
Overhead construction can be affected adversely as well. This is particularity true in the case of roofing leaks and plumbing mishaps. If this is the case, whether from bad pipes or bad roofing material, one must be cautious in the extreme when moving in and around such damage. Falling ceilings can do great bodily damage along with the structural damage, and tremendous care should be taken to minimize any risk.
Foundations may be suffering eh least damage, oddly enough, if those foundations are made of poured or block cement. Concrete does well in water, but the key here is to pay attention to the earth on which that foundation is resting. Flooding can undermine once solid ground and create serious problems for any sized building. Along with this idea is that of being very aware of any electrical issues that may arise. Water added to electrical supplies is a problem in and of itself, so these structural issues must be heeded along with the rest.
